u/Current-Purpose-6106 13h ago

You should watch them before making claims I think. Just for your own sake.

Take the 'Psychedelics Allow Alien Communication, Scientists Claim'

The claim was DMT and other hallucinogenic drugs let people have shared hallucinations. This paper went out and then surveyed people to see what their hallucinations were of. Then the folks claim that since these are shared, and since people have encounters with these 'entities', that there is something there.

Well she spends about 3m talking about the paper. Then 6m talking about how this is ridiculous because its not an experiment, its not falsifiable, etc. It's just data without any understanding of why we share those hallucinations.

Then takes it a step further and says if they're serious (and they're not), then the obvious experiment would be put a word or a color on a computer in another room. Then the 'experiencer' who can communicate with these supernatural entities could gain the information from them. But they can't. Because it's not real

Hossenfelder concludes that while the shared, specific hallucinations triggered by DMT are a fascinating psychological mystery that genuinely warrants study, the paper's mathematical framework is nonsense. She rates the claim that we are communicating with real alien consciousnesses a "10 out of 10 on the bullshit meter"

You're falling for clickbait in the weirdest way and I kind of love it. It's weird that it's being used to ...draw the complete opposite conclusion from reality.

She can be a tough listen sometimes. She can certainly come off sometimes as pompous. But peddler of quack science, she is most definitely not. Extremely opinionated though, absolutely. Sometimes to a fault
